We first started using and developing our zone blitz package with
our Tampa Bay Buccaneer team in the late 70ís. At that time
the basic concept was to bring as many different people from as many
different angles as we could against the offensive team we were
facing.

In our consideration to move to a zone blitz package there were seven
basic questions that we wanted to consider and answer before we spent
the time designing and integrating this style of defense into our
base defensive scheme.
1. The first thing we considered was the personnel that
we had on our team. If we had not had linebackers who could
effectively rush the passer and penetrate the line of scrimmage we
would not have considered embarking on this style of defense.
2. We wanted to make certain that any zone blitz package that we
used would create confusion for the offense and in some way
disrupt their normal blocking schemes.
3. It was very important for us to know if this was a package
which we could develop and run from both of our three and four
defensive linemen alignments.
4. We wanted to determine if this style of defense was one that we
could run using both two and three deep coverages and not just a
defense that locked us into one or the other.
5. In using this style of defense we had to ask ourselves if we
would be willing to design and include a zone blitz package where
we vacated a zone in our coverage that would normally be covered
by a linebacker.
6. We also felt we needed to evaluate our defensive line personnel
to determine if there were individual players in this group that
we could, on occasion, drop into coverage.
7. Finally, it was very important that this style of defensive
package be effective against the run as well as the passing game.
We began our design from our 3 - 4 defense and concentrated on
developing a package where we could bring any one of our linebackers
or a single defensive back and still be in position to play either a
two or three deep zone coverage.
This was followed with the development of bringing a single
linebacker in a coordinated stunt with one of our defensive
linemen.
Our next design concept was also from the 3 - 4 defense where we
would bring a combination of two linebackers and drop a defensive
lineman into the coverage scheme. This was usually done in
conjunction with a two deep coverage so that we did not have to
vacate a zone.
Our final design was the employment of special five man pressure
packages that we would design where we understood that we were
vacating an underneath zone in order to put pressure on the offensive
blocking scheme.
